Não consegui encontrar nenhum tutorial sobre como fazer isso. O vídeo do Spaceinvader One “Como direcionar qualquer container docker através de um container VPN” usa uma imagem diferente, então não está claro como alcançar o mesmo resultado para Radarr.
Sei que eu não preciso de VPN para Radarr. Ainda quero usar. É uma preferência pessoal.
Edit: A razão pela qual não quero discutir sobre usar VPN ou não para Radar é porque:
- Segurança é sobre avaliação de risco. Pessoas e situações diferentes exigirã medidas diferentes. Tecnicamente falando; as pessoas terão diferentes tolerância ao risco e apetite pelo risco.
- Este post não é sobre VPN em geral. Não trata nem mesmo da funcionalidade do Radarr. É sobre como configurar um container Docker no Unraid com VPN.
- Acredito que perguntas gerais sobre VPN pertencem ao r/vpn e outros lugares.
- Na pior hipótese, estou cometendo um erro ao usar VPN, mas nesse caso, não vejo problema além da velocidade reduzida da rede, o que não me importa. Sei o suficiente para decidir sobre isso.
Por quê? VPN para o cliente de download eu posso entender. Mas para Radarr? Não vai proteger seus downloads.
Não posso acreditar que, após horas ontem, consegui fazer isso funcionar. Estou tentando fazer o mesmo que você está e finalmente descobri.
Estou usando binhex/arch-privoxyvpn graças a este guia (também uso PIA). Meu erro foi pensar que --net=container:privoxyvpn
era o mesmo que usar docker network create container:privoxyvpn
e ter isso como o tipo de conexão para qualquer container que eu queira direcionar pelo VPN. Aparentemente, é diferente. Se alguém puder explicar, por favor, faça isso porque tenho usado o unRAID por uma semana (poucas horas no total)…
Adicionei as portas que o sabnzbd estava usando ao VPN_INPUT_PORTS
e VPN_OUTPUT_PORTS
. Criei uma nova variável de porta para sabnzbd e configurei a “Porta do Container” para a porta padrão do sabnzbd e a “Porta do Host” para o que eu usava para acessá-lo antes de enviá-lo pelo VPN.
Fiz o mesmo com os aplicativos Servarr e funcionou muito bem. Verificar o IP de cada app direcionado pelo container privoxyvpn mostra que está usando o VPN!
Para fazer tudo funcionar bem, criei uma pasta de aplicativos onde o container VPN inicia primeiro, seguido de tudo que depende dele.